Grand Canyon Village has a population of 1,504 people, according to the Census data for 2016.
Compared to 2010, this number has decreased by 500 people (25%), so we can confidently say that the dynamics of the population growth are negative. If you compare the rate of population growth with the nearest cities, such as Fredonia or Parks, you will find that these cities have a population growth of 374 and a growth of 274 people, respectively (28.5% and 23.1% correspondingly)

The Grand Canyon Village median household income is $38,137 (according to the US Census Bureau records for 2016).
A household income is one of the easiest to understand statistical indicators that is used to evaluate the economy of the city. Simply put, it is calculated by summarizing incomes of all adult members of the household. In comparison with the data for year 2010, this figure has decreased by $1030 (2.6%). Compared with the neighboring cities, the median household income in Grand Canyon Village is lower than in Cornville($38,900), but greater than in Central($38,077). The median household income in Arizonais $50,255 (31.8% higher than in Grand Canyon Village)

The median property value in Grand Canyon Village is $36,700 (based on US Census Bureau data for 2016)
. This means that half of the houses in the city are more expensive than this figure, and half of other houses are less. In 2010, the property value was estimated at $19,600 (making an increase of $17,100 or 87.2% in 6 years). Here is what the housing market looks like in nearby cities: median property price in Kayentais $50,600, in Chloride— $36,600. Median property value in Arizona is $167,500

A poverty rate is one of the key economic indicators.
It shows the proportion of the population whose income is less than the poverty line in the area. The lower the number is, the more prosperous the life of society is. The current poverty rate in Grand Canyon Village is 28.5%. In the neighboring cities, this figure is as follows: in Aguila, 31.0% of the population live below the poverty line, in Cordes Lakes— 23.7%. The poverty rate in Arizonais 13.29%. Based on such indicators as the poverty rate, we assume that life in Grand Canyon Village is worse than the average for the state.

The median gross rent in Grand Canyon Village is $585 a month (as of 2016).
In 2010, this figure was higher — $606/mo (+3.5%). Please note, gross rent may include not only the rent payments, but also utility bills and some other building costs. The median gross rent in the state of Arizonais higher at $913 per month (again, data for 2016). The following median gross rent was registered in the neighboring cities: renters in New Harmonypay $588/mo, in Circleville— $567/mo.

The rent burden in Grand Canyon Village is 17.0% (2016).
Rent burden shows what proportion of the household income is spent on rental housing. This data is useful in estimating the housing affordability in the city. Rent burden in Grand Canyon Village is lower than in the state of Arizona, where the rent burden is 30.1%. In neighboring cities, the situation is as follows: rent burden is 18.0% in Cottonwood, and in Peach Springs— 15.6%.

73.6% of housing units in Grand Canyon Village are occupied by renters (2016).
A housing unit means a house, an apartment, a mobile home, a room or any other structure that is used for habitation. In 2010, the share of renter-occupied housing units was higher — 84.4%. It seems that now less people live in rented houses in Grand Canyon Village than before. Neighboring cities have the following shares of renter-occupied housing units: Hildale(90.5%), Peach Springs(61.7%).

Grand Canyon Village is a city in Arizona. 2,004 residents reside in the city. The city covers an area of 13.40 sq mi (34.71 km2). Grand Canyon Village has a land area of 13.40 sq mi (34.71 km2). Grand Canyon Village has a water area of 0.00 sq mi (0.00 km2). The city has a density of 22.2/sq mi (57.74/km2). Grand Canyon Village is 6,804 ft (2,074 m) above the sea level. Grand Canyon Village area code is 928. Grand Canyon Village is in the UTC-7 (MST) time zone. The FIPS code is 04-2408314. The GNIS ID is 2408314
